  53. #ifndef HEADER_CMAC_H
  54. #define HEADER_CMAC_H
  55. #ifdef __cplusplus
  56. extern "C" {
  57. #endif
  58. #include <openssl/evp.h>
  59. /* Opaque */
  60. typedef struct CMAC_CTX_st CMAC_CTX;
  61. CMAC_CTX *CMAC_CTX_new(void);
  62. void CMAC_CTX_cleanup(CMAC_CTX *ctx);
  63. void CMAC_CTX_free(CMAC_CTX *ctx);
  64. EVP_CIPHER_CTX *CMAC_CTX_get0_cipher_ctx(CMAC_CTX *ctx);
  65. int CMAC_CTX_copy(CMAC_CTX *out, const CMAC_CTX *in);
  66. int CMAC_Init(CMAC_CTX *ctx, const void *key, size_t keylen,
  67. const EVP_CIPHER *cipher, ENGINE *impl);
  68. int CMAC_Update(CMAC_CTX *ctx, const void *data, size_t dlen);
  69. int CMAC_Final(CMAC_CTX *ctx, unsigned char *out, size_t *poutlen);
  70. int CMAC_resume(CMAC_CTX *ctx);
  71. #ifdef __cplusplus
  72. }
  73. #endif
  74. #endif
